What are the different types of flower bulbs?

Flower Bulbs are some of the most versatile plants in the area. There are many different types of bulbs that can be grown for almost any purpose. The bulbs also thrive under a wide range of cultivation conditions. Spring bulbs are usually planted in autumn. These durable bulbs require cold periods to cause flowering and healthy growth. They are some of the first flowers that were seen early in the spring. Popular spring flower bulbs include crocuses, daffodils, tulips and hyacinths. Crocus flowers are quite attractive, usually purple or purple colors. Narcissses are well known for their foot yellow flowers. These bulbs also come in various other colors such as pink and white and different sizes. They are also good bulbs for discouraging deer and rodents from the area.

Flower bulbs are planted in the spring for summer flowering. These bulbs require lifting in autumn in frost temperatures. They are normally stored throughout the winter because they cannot tolerate cold conditions. The common bulbs of summer flowers include Lily, Dahlia, Gladiolus and Tuberous Begonia.
